Honestly,
I
give
this
place
five
stars
because
when
you’re
paying
£20
for
somewhere
to
stay
for
a
night
in
central
London,
you
get
what
you
pay
for.
I
honestly
didn’t
mind
this
place
at
all,
and
actually
enjoyed
the
stay
more
than
I
expected
I
would.
The
lounge
spaces
were
big,
with
lots
of
charging
ports,
and
upstairs
in
the
room
it
was
pretty
tidy,
along
with
the
bathrooms
and
showers.
The
staff
were
really
nice
and
talkative
during
check-in,
so
I’d
definitely
be
willing
to
stay
here
again.
However,
just
in
case
this
is
your
first
time
using
a
youth
hostel,
there’s
a
couple
things
I
would
note.
The
windows
in
the
hostel
were
open
all
night,
which
meant
noise
was
let
in,
however
there
is
an
expectation
that
this
will
be
the
case.
Being
in
a
room
with
10
people,
with
Covid,
I
expected
this
would
happen
so
bought
ear
plugs
with
me
and
I
would
recommend
you
do
too
as
it
was
a
great
help.
Considering
that
it
is
winter,
I
actually
woke
up
in
the
night
feeling
quite
warm,
so
the
windows
didn’t
affect
the
temperature
at
all.
The
lockers
to
keep
your
things
in
our
downstairs
near
reception,
so
remember
a
padlock,
but
during
the
night
I
actually
kept
my
bag
on
my
bed
for
convenience.
I
had
no
issues
here
whatsoever,
maybe
my
only
thing
would
be
if
I
could
have
an
extra
few
pillows
on
the
bed
as
that
wasn’t
particularly
comfy.
But
perhaps
this
is
something
you
can
ask
for.
Overall,
it
was
decent
for
what
you’re
paying
for.
